Leogang

Saalbach has ski slopes on both sides of the valley. The North facing ones have snow right down to the valley floor, the South facing ones are heavily reliant on artificial snow. I started off on the North ones, but as the two runs I wanted to do were both shut, I headed over the other side, and skied down to Leogang (also North facing). Conditions weren't too bad, but the ski back into the village was hard work.
